Be careful what you ask for, you just may get it. Willie Wiersma, defensive coordinator of the 9- and10-year-old Arlington Blue Midgets football team, may be saying that to himself after having his head shaved Friday, Oct. 27.
The Blue Midgets won their first playoff game 26-0 Saturday, Oct. 28.
Wiersma told his squad early in the season that if they went undefeated he would have his head shaved and they could all autograph his shiny top.
After going 8-0 in the regular season, Wiersma took a chair at Magic Shears and owner Randy Howell proceeded to shear away weeks of growth.
This was the worst idea Ive ever had, Wiersma jokingly said upon exiting the chair and paying the $15 dollar haircut fee. With all joking aside, he said his first time with a completely shaved head actually feels great.
The entire team and their parents crowded around Howell both inside the store and watched with video cameras from the sidewalk peering through the windows.
